Two arrests were made outside the courthouse during Karmelo Anthony's murder trial sentencing. Jerome Winston Parker was arrested for unlawful carrying of a weapon, while Sholdon Daniels was charged with public intoxication. Both incidents occurred amid heightened tensions surrounding the trial, which concluded with Anthony being sentenced to 35 years in prison for the murder of Austin Metcalf.

Jerome Winston Parker was arrested on June 9 for unlawful carrying of a weapon during the Karmelo Anthony murder trial. Parker had previously gained attention for confrontations with supporters of the victim, Austin Metcalf. Additionally, Sholdon Daniels was arrested for public intoxication during the proceedings and criticized the jail release process on social media.
